Sanders Stumps for Single-Payer Health Care System
Sen. Bernie Sanders (I-Vt.), who is seeking the Democratic presidential nomination, said "the time has come" for a "single-payer, national health care program" and that he would introduce a bill to establish such a system "in the very near future." Sanders said a single-payer health care system would be cost-effective and would allow Medicare to negotiate with drugmakers, which currently is prohibited.
